From 5327d931acc20ce524e57cb5412ebf2c8b15b34d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jaegeuk Kim Date: Thu, 4 Jul 2019 18:09:38 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] logcatd: fallocate and fadvise to logcat files 1. Pinning and fallocating blocks can avoid filesystem fragmentation. 2. Dropping caches can avoid memory pressure. 3.
